Frequently Asked Questions
Can I install a 48A charger on a 40A breaker?
Yes, but you must configure the internal dip switches or app commissioning to cap output at 32A continuous to prevent tripping the breaker.
Is hardwiring safer than using a NEMA 14-50 plug?
Yes. Hardwiring eliminates plug receptacle contact points, which are the #1 failure mode for EV charging thermal meltdowns.
